Wish they would have made a 2023 Pathfinder Rockcreek Pro 4X with a 9.5 ground clearance.Not quite there from a ground clearance perspective - Pathfinder Rock Creek = 7.1 + 0.6 = 7.7" whereas the Forester/Outback Wilderness is up at 9.2". How/Where did you get the power/harness to install the auto-dimming mirror on a RC?I added the auto dimming mirror to mine. Pretty cheap and definitely easy to DIY.
I bought the mirror from a member on here. Came with the 2 wire harness that came with his framless mirror. Bought the accessory add wiring harness from Nissan for $13 that plugs in under the dash. Ran an additional wire from the new mirror to the harness with the 2 wire harness for the HomeLink and auto dim feature to work properly.How/Where did you get the power/harness to install the auto-dimming mirror on a RC?
